Swiss Franc Strengthens on Uncertainty

The Swiss franc is experiencing a surge in value as investors flock to the perceived safety of the currency. Heightened uncertainty in global markets is fueling demand, leading to its appreciation against other major currencies.

Factors Contributing to Franc’s Strength

  • Global Economic Uncertainty: Concerns about slowing economic growth in major economies, particularly the United States, are driving investors towards safer assets.
  • Geopolitical Risks: Ongoing geopolitical tensions and conflicts are further contributing to risk aversion in the market.
  • Switzerland’s Stable Economy: Switzerland’s consistently strong economy and stable political environment make it an attractive destination for investors seeking to preserve capital.
  • Swiss National Bank (SNB) Policy: While the SNB typically intervenes to curb excessive franc appreciation, its current stance appears to be more tolerant, allowing the currency to find its natural level.

Impact on Swiss Economy

The strengthening franc presents both challenges and opportunities for the Swiss economy. While it may dampen export competitiveness, it also lowers the cost of imports and can help to curb inflation.

Analysts predict that the franc’s strength is likely to persist in the near term, as global uncertainties continue to weigh on market sentiment. Investors will be closely watching developments in the global economy and any potential policy responses from the SNB.
